Unitus Community Credit Union announces key leadership promotions

Credit Union promotes three to Senior Vice President Roles, strengthening executive leadership

Tigard, OR (July 1, 2025) |

 Unitus Community Credit Union is announcing the promotion of  three accomplished leaders to Senior Vice President roles, reinforcing its commitment to internal  talent development and visionary leadership.

Jessica Brown has been named Senior Vice President/Chief People and Culture Officer, reflecting her instrumental role in shaping Unitus’ inclusive and people-centered workplace. In this elevated position, she will continue leading human resources and culture initiatives that foster belonging, empowerment, and professional growth across the organization. 

“This role is a continuation of the work I care deeply about: creating an environment where every employee feels seen, supported, and inspired to grow,” said Ms. Brown. 

Char Sears has been promoted to Senior Vice President/Chief Growth Officer, where she will  spearhead strategies to expand and deepen member relationships through data-driven insights,  digital innovation, and personalized engagement. Her leadership will drive sustainable growth and  elevate the member experience. 

“Our growth isn’t just about numbers—it’s about deepening trust with every member we serve,”  said Ms. Sears. “In this role, I’m excited to bring bold ideas forward that help shape the future of  member engagement by bringing together technology, strategy, and heart.” 

Megan Snyder has been appointed Senior Vice President/Chief Impact Officer, advancing the credit  union’s mission-driven efforts to serve the community and build strong, strategic partnerships.  Megan will lead initiatives focused on financial inclusion, social responsibility, and community  development. 

“I’m honored to lead our impact work at such a pivotal time,” said Ms. Snyder. “This new role  allows us to deepen our commitment to the communities we serve and drive meaningful change  through partnerships and purpose.” 

“These promotions are a reflection of the extraordinary leadership, vision, and passion Jessica,  Char, and Megan bring to Unitus every day,” said David Fehrer, Executive Vice President/Chief  Strategy and Innovation Officer. “Each of them has made a lasting impact on our organization, and  we’re excited for the future as they step into these important roles.”

Each SVP will now serve as part of the Executive Leadership Team at Unitus.
